About Spredfast
Spredfast is a social software company and platform, headquartered in Austin, Texas with offices in New York City, London, Madison, Wisconsin, and Sydney, that seeks to connect every company in the world with the people that they care about the most. Spredfast’s “Smart Social” software enables companies to manage, integrate, and amplify social content across any digital touch point. With global reach, Spredfast customers have managed more than one billion social connections across 84 countries.
Summary
The position requires an exceptionally accomplished mid-level lawyer with a distinguished professional record, strong business orientation, a creative and problem solving mindset and strategic agility. The ideal candidate will be a corporate generalist who has occupied a mid-level legal advisor role in a high tech corporation with a global footprint. Prior law firm experience strongly preferred. The successful candidate must have exemplary ethics and integrity, solid judgment and business acumen, and the ability to partner with and support the business to achieve key goals. Ideally the candidate will have public company or IPO experience. The Corporate Counsel will report to the Chief Legal Officer.
Responsibilities
* Provide common sense, risk based legal advice and solutions regarding issues and risks in a high-growth, extremely dynamic environment. * Advise on business transactions, including the preparation, review and negotiation of agreements in a variety of areas. * Negotiate and draft master subscription agreements, professional services agreements and a variety of other agreements. * Provide legal counsel and support in business development activities, including conducting due diligence. * Partner with the business, real-time, on various projects and serve as legal negotiator on legal aspects of customer, partner and other transactions.
Ideal Candidate
* Juris Doctorate (J.D.) & in good standing with the TX, CA or NY Bar * 4-7 years legal experience, and strong academic credentials * Counseling pre-IPO and public companies on disclosure, corporate governance, and SEC and stock exchange reporting and compliance matters preferred. * Experience in a major law firm and/or in-house legal department, with a focus on a broad range of SEC filings (including 10-Ks, 10-Qs, 8-Ks and proxy statements) preferred. * Stellar communication skills, including the ability to engage efficiently with internal business partners, to negotiate with external parties effectively and the ability to draft clear and concise correspondence and documents. * Exceptional attention to detail and quality control. * Ability to efficiently manage multiple projects, to organize, prioritize, and reorder workload efficiently in a dynamic environment. * Ability to work both independently and as part of a team. * Flexible thinker with the ability to make sound independent decisions. * Basic knowledge and ability to provide common sense advice on a variety of legal areas, including corporate, employment, privacy and cybersecurity, contract management, intellectual property, etc.
